Any ideas on how to get phone numbers for expired MLS listings?

Ryan Dossey
  • Real Estate Broker
  • Indianapolis, IN
Posted

Myself and another BP member are going to go through and reach out to expired listings on homes that (among other criteria) required a special sales contract. The thought is hopefully we get some motivated people with homes needing work. Fix flip and wholesale. Is there an easy way to get the contact info for people? Website? I know if they have a land line the yellow/whitepage will do it. But lets be honest a good majority of people only have cell phones now. I'm thinking I could post it on FIVERR and see if I get any bites.
